Job Summary
Roles and Responsibilities:
- Coordinate equipment repairs of Service Life Extension Program SLEP equipment on LCU
- Troubleshoot and repair of vessel SLEP equipment
- Assist Army maintainers with maintenance on SLEP equipment
- Work closely with logistics to order parts and equipment
- Complete maintenance faults and tracks faults to closeout
Basic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in manufacturing engineering or process engineering (Additional 8 years of experience may be substituted in lieu of degree)
- 2 to 4 years related engineering experience or Army Watercraft experience
- At least 4 years of Ship Repair experience or Shipboard experience in Army/Naval Service.
- Must be experienced and knowledge with all facets of Integrated Support for shipboard Hull, Mechanical and Electrical Systems (HM&E), Electronics Systems, Combat Systems or marine systems.
- Must have a working knowledge of Army watercraft Standard items, General Specs for Overhaul of Surface Ships and familiarity with Army Ship Tech Manual.
- Candidates must be a citizen of the United States of America and be able to obtain a Common Access Card (CAC).
Preferred Qualifications:
- Have the ability to read and interpret various ship drawings for SLEP Systems, Electronics Systems or Combat Systems.
- Landing Craft Utility (LCU) experience as Watercraft Maintenance officer
- Understanding of Army maritime operations and vessel operations
- 8 years of ship repair experience
- Knowledgeable with Landing Craft, Utility (LCU) Service Life Extension Program (SLEP) equipment
- Army watercraft maintenance officer or vessel chief
